Paul Hart finally got to see his team in action this evening as Forest played their first pre-season friendly in this country.
 
The squad travelled to Underhill today to face Barnet, who lost their league status at the end of last season.
 
Forest were comfortable for the whole game, however, they left it until nine minutes from the end before opening the scoring.
 
The first goal came from Jermain Jenas who curled in a superb shot from just outside the 18-yard box.
 
Two minutes later Jack Lester added the second as Forest turned up the pressure. And in injury time Keith Foy fired home a superb free-kick.
